Is Private Equity easier to get into as an associate if you were previously an analyst?

I know that recruiting for PE is very difficult as an associate. Let's say, however, you're currently an associate at a solid BB and had 2-3 years of previous analyst experience at a BB, does it make PE recruiting much easier? Or at that point are you really just too expensive to bring on that late in the game?

For context, I have accepted a return offer at a BB and was just curious, as someone who has seriously considered IB long-term, what exit ops look like later down the road for someone who is not a fresh, post-MBA associate.
